Geometric arrays intersect and rotate becoming kaleidoscopic labyrinthian visual mazes.
This project started as a study of geometric interconnected arrays spinning into final positions causing pretty overlapping patterns as they settle. Using the real-time capabilities of cables.gl coupled with FXHash's GPU previewers I was able to use the actual depth of the 3d objects to inform the shader on how to "draw" the shapes.
